Advertisement
Guest User

Untitled

a guest
Jan 24th, 2019
88
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
R 0.28 KB | None | 0 0
  1.  
  2. tst_df <- data.frame(id = letters[1:5], x = 1:5, y = 6:10)
  3. tst_df
  4.  
  5.  
  6. m_dist_wrapper <- function(a,b) {
  7.   apply(b,2, function(x) m_dist(a,x))
  8. }
  9.  
  10. m_dist <- function(a,b) {
  11.   # b = c(b1,b2)
  12.   sqrt(sum((a-b)^2))
  13. }
  14.  
  15. tst_df %>% mutate ( abc = m_dist_wrapper(c(1,1), rbind(x,y) ))
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ement